Tank filled with incorrect fuel - Diesel engine filled with petrol fuel is harmful and should be given consideration straight away. Your vehicle will begin to show some signs like an unusual amount of smoke in the exhaust. It will cough and splutter too. Not just that, starting the engine back is practically impossible once you've switched it off.

Water in car?s tank - The ideal way to eliminate the water in the tank is to flash it out or issues while the car is running will be noticed. These include engine to rev up, cough and splutter. Water contamination is not just common in boats. This can happen to cars too when the jerry cans are utilized to fill the tank with fuel. There is a possibility that these cans still have water in it and were included in refilling your car?s tank.

Diesel Tank with AdBlue - This contaminant can be added by accident or intentionally. Vehicle owners don't have enough understanding about AdBlue. That's precisely why they are in this problem now. Contrary to what many have stated that it is an additive, the reality is AdBlue is a liquid that helps minimizethe emission of harmful smoke in your exhaust and this must have a separate tank. More motorists are falling foul of AdBlue contamination every day, and it's our job to fix it for you.

Red diesel contamination - This incident rarely happens to vehicle owners but often it finds its way to a car?s tank. There are instances were filling this fuel take place because of tiredness or distraction. According to AA, there are 1500 garages in UK that sell this diesel. There is indeed a chance of it getting in to your tank. If that happens, we know how to deal with it.

Driving with Old Fuel - As time passes by and your car is idle for a while, the quality of your fuel degrades. This occurs if the vehicle is not driven and has been on standby for a long time and the fuel has been in the tank unused. Your engine might start and run, but it probably won't run as well.
